Hotels in London near Royal Arcade
We found 5130 properties with availability in London
Amazingly Luxurious Loft Apartment, Soho - 3 Bedrooms, 2 Bath & Office
10 Richmond Mews Flat 28 Soho Lofts, London, United Kingdom
Stay Mayfair
Mayfair, London, United Kingdom
Woodstock Residence
16 Woodstock Street, London, United Kingdom
Spacious 2 Bedroom Apartment In Soho No Lift 11Wd
100 Wardour Street Flat 11, London, United Kingdom
20 Hertford Street - Mayfair Apartments
20 Hertford Street, London, United Kingdom
Private Studio - Wardour Street - Berwick Street
D'Arblay Street, London, United Kingdom
Astor Oxford Street
14 Noel Street, London, W1F 8Gj, London, United Kingdom
Soho Apartments F2
28 D'Arblay Street, London, United Kingdom
Soho Apartments F4
28 D'Arblay Street, London, United Kingdom
The Soho Carolina - New
Berwick Street, London, United Kingdom
Central Quality Point Piccadilly
36 Goodge St,, London, United Kingdom
Modern Studio On Wardour Street In The Heart Of Soho, 1St Floor, No Lift 2Wd
98A Wardour Street Flat 2, London, United Kingdom
Buckingham Elegance
26 Mount Street Apartment, London, United Kingdom
The Mayfair Majesty
26 Mount Street Basement, London, United Kingdom
Wardour Street Soho Modern Studio, 1 And 2 Bedroom Apartments
98 Wardour Street, London, United Kingdom
Chic 1-Bed Flat In The Heart Of Soho Wardour Street! No Lift 1Wd
98 Wardour Street Flat 1, London, United Kingdom
Stylish & Bright Studio In The Heart Of Soho Unbeatable Location! No Lift Wd8
98 Wardour Street Flat 8, London, United Kingdom
Stylish 1-Bedroom Apartment In The Heart Of Soho! No Lift 9Wd
98 Wardour Street Flat 9, London, United Kingdom
Stylish 1-Bedroom In The Heart Of Soho! No Lift Wd3
98 Wardour Street Flat 3, London, United Kingdom
Soho Living Chic 1Br Flat On Wardour Street, 2Nd Floor - No Lift 4Wd
98 Wardour Street Flat 4, London, United Kingdom